Ensuring Brand Compatibility for WS2811 LED Pixel Strips

To ensure brand compatibility for WS2811 LED pixel strips, several critical factors must be addressed:
- Signal Degradation: Longer strips can suffer from signal loss and color bleeding. Incorporating buffer strips at regular intervals, using shielded wires, and employing high-quality driver ICs can mitigate these issues.
- Power Supply Optimization: Optimizing the power supply and ensuring direct wiring contribute to maintaining signal integrity. High-power controllers and distribution boards help manage long-distance connections.
- Component Selection: Choosing appropriate components, such as signal filters, buffers, and ferrite beads, is essential for managing noise and EMI. High-pass and low-pass filters, along with resistors and capacitors, are necessary for stable signal handling.

For new users, a comprehensive troubleshooting guide is beneficial, covering common issues like flickering and incorrect color output. This guide should provide specific steps for diagnosing and resolving problems to enhance user satisfaction and project success.

Best Practices for Using WS2811 LED Pixel Strips: Beginners Guide

When using WS2811 LED pixel strips, it is crucial to adhere to best practices for optimal performance and longevity:
- Maintain Voltage: Keep the strip's voltage between 4.75 V and 5.25 - Signal Protocol: Ensure the data signal protocol and clock speed align with the controller specifications.
- Soft Shutdown: Use a capacitor to gradually reduce power for a soft shutdown and prevent data corruption.
- Clean Reset: Employ a short delay on the data line or pull it low to reset cleanly.
- Smart Home: These strips can be programmed to react to voice commands or sensor inputs.
- Quality and Compatibility: Prioritize quality and compatibility with controllers, especially for indoor and outdoor use.
- Installation and Maintenance: Properly secure the strips and protect them from moisture.

For beginners, leveraging user-friendly libraries like Adafruit NeoPixel can simplify initialization and management, allowing for easy integration into projects.


Integration Considerations and Compatibility Issues

Integrating WS2811 LED pixel strips into various systems and environments requires careful consideration:
- Signal Integrity: Signal degradation over long distances can lead to incorrect color outputs and timing delays. Deploying signal buffers and using high-quality cables helps improve signal quality.
- Power Supply: A stable and consistent power supply is crucial to avoid performance disruptions. Use distribution boards and powered extension cords to manage large installations.
- Design Principles: Implement a unified software interface with proper timing mechanisms to ensure interoperability across different nodes and departments.

These practices help create a robust foundation for long-lasting and efficient WS2811 installations, whether in complex smart home systems or large-scale commercial buildings.
